Okay we're going to start talking about the trays
because we always like to move from the bottom up on our machines.
On the T47, the tray Is very different from the other two machines
because the T47's tray, you pull it out and then you slide it upwards
in order to adjust how it is that you're going to brew
into a smaller cup or mug or something along those lines.
Whereas over here on the 55 and the 65, these trays
first of all they lock in, they're removable as are all of the trays,
But one of the things that you're going to notice about these trays
is that they have these small levers
and you just move those levers to the left or the right,
and when you move them, that adjusts the height of the tray.
Now another distinct difference here is the amount of clearance
that you have from the tray to the brew spigot
on both the T47 and the T55.
This is all over that the T65 where the clearance is definitely much less.
The reason for this is that the T47 and the T55 are both part of
what we're calling the second generation of Bosch Tassimo machines.
Which also leads to some other differences
that we'll talk about as we move up in the machine,
but that's definitely a distinct one,
is that clearance that you have between tray and brew spigot.
So let's move up to the brew spigot, and as I say, the T47 and the T55,
these are both part of the second generation
of the Bosch Tassimo machines.
And what makes them very different and part of the second gen
is the locking mechanisms for the brew trays.
Very different with this front-facing, fold-down and locking mechanism;
whereas over here on the T65,
you're going to notice that it's kind of spring-loaded.
I open it and it just sort of opens by itself,
but it looks very different and locks down in a very different fashion.
And also because there's this locking ring inside of the unit right here.
This locking ring, when you press on this tab it loosens the locking ring.
And what this does is this locks down your T Disc.
Let's talk about water tanks on all three of these machines.
Now the T47 and the T55 both have the same size water tank, 47 ounces.
On the T65 you have a larger one, 61 ounces.
Now the T65 and the T55 both
give you the option to add a water filter to the tank.
Now the T47 does not have a water filter to be added to the water tank,
so that's a distinct difference between the T47 over the 55 and 65.
One more thing worth mentioning, is that you're going to notice
that the tank for the T65 has a handle and a lid.
And on that lid is an indicator which allows you
to set a new time length for when you put in a new water filter.
However, over here on the T55 and the 47,
these water tanks just slide in to the back of the unit.
On the T55 there is an indicator which allows you to reset
when you last put a water filter in,
but it's on the top of the unit right here.
And then again, on the T47, because it has no water filter
you do not have that indicator
for when you last replaced the water filter.
Let's talk about the buttons on all of these machines,
because there are some distinct differences.
Let's start with the T47.
The T47 is probably the most simple operation of all these machines.
It's one single button, and you simply press that to brew,
use that for adding more water to your beverage and all those
other different operations you can do using the one button.
On the T55, this button is a little more involved.
You have the one single button which allows you start brewing,
but then you also have these two buttons that are on the top
and the bottom of that brew button.
What these do is they allow you to vary the amount of water
that you're going to add to the beverage.
So this machine, over the others, in that sense,
allows you to really change the brew strength.
Usually that's all done using the intelligent barcode technology.
that exists in all of these machines.
Now over here on the T65, it again has that one single button,
but this button is multi-use,
and that leads me to talk about the screens on each of these.
Now you do have a small LCD display on the T65, and that's going to
give you some information about when you're brewing and when
it's time to descale the machine, and some various things like that.
It's backlit blue, which is cool and very easy to read.
Now you don't have that on either the T55 or the 47.
On both of these, what you have is just a three LED display
which tells you when the machine is ready to brew,
when it's time to descale the machine, when it's time to add water
and various operations such as that.
I do find it a little unfortunate that these machines,
for being second generation machines,
do not have these LCD screens on them of some kind,
but I imagine maybe we could see that in the future
and we're just seeing that on these brand new second generation machines
that Bosch has decided to take out that LCD screen.
That leads me into talking about
the brew stations for each of these machines.
Now again, they're all pretty much the same with the exception
of the locking mechanisms on the 47 and the 55.
However, they all use the intelligent barcode technology
which Bosch has pioneered with their single serve machines.
Inside of the brew station for each of these machines is a barcode reader.
That barcode reader will read a barcode on a T Disc,
and if we take out T Disc,
right here I'll just show you what this looks like.
Each T Disc has a barcode on it, and that barcode is read by the machine,
and that barcode includes the information about
how that machine should brew that specific T Disc
that you happen to be putting into the machine.
So they all make use of the same intelligent barcode technology,
it's just that each of them has a different way of locking down
and keeping that T Disc inside the machine while it brews your beverage.
Let's talk about pricing on all of these machines.
Now on the T47, again, a second generation Bosch Tassimo machine,
you're looking at $139.99.
On the Tassimo T55 and the T65
you're looking at the same price point, $169.99.

So bottom line on all these machines.
They all have very much the same operation, as I say,
simple one button operation.
Some of those buttons, there's a little bit more, and access
some other features on the machine, but brewing is very simple.
They all use the intelligent barcode technology.
All of them use T Discs,
and they can all do a number of different beverages:
hot coffees, hot teas, iced coffees, iced teas and specialty drinks
like lattes, cappuccinos and hot chocolates.
So you do get a lot of different options when it comes to brewing
with all three of these machines.
The trays obviously are a little bit different,
especially on the T47 as opposed to the T55 and the 65.
But really they're all very simple and easy to use,
it's just that that clearance difference is definitely
a distinct difference between the 47, the 55
and comparing those to the T65.
Of course, the brewing mechanisms themselves, very, very different.
As I say, this is little more secure on the second generation machines,
really locks down on that T Disc and makes sure that you get
the best possible pressure to get your brew.
Over here on the T65, again it's a good and well-built operation
in order for brewing your T Disc, but it is a little more involved
because you have to actually pop that T Disc holder ring up,
and put your T Disc in.
It might take a little more time than some folks are really
willing to deal with, as a downside over here in the T65.
And of course, finally when it comes to looks and overall operation,
they all look really good,
they don't take up a lot of space, they don't weigh very much.
They all have fairly sizable water tanks.
The T65's is a little bit bigger.
The T65 looks a little cooler with the LCD screen,
but overall I don't think that that's really a game-changer
when you're talking about your second generation machines
because they really still offer all the same cool features
that you can get with a Bosch Tassimo machine.
